While Amazon has a quintessential presence in the e-commerce
space online, it is rather difficult to imagine the scale at which
the AWS functions in terms of hardware.
The AWS is located in 8 locations including US, Europe, Asia,
Brazil and Australia. Each zone has distinct data centres
providing AW services.
It is a discreet and decentralized IT infrastructure that exists all
around the world and serves two purposes – coverage and ease
of access.

AWS include a lot of services that map across different possible
functions or features a client might want to deploy in its
application implementation.
They are listed under the genres of computing they fall under.
Amazon Elastic Compute Cloud (or better known as EC2).
It is at the heart of Amazon Web Services; it allows users to buy
virtual compute servers to run their applications.
Users working on this service boot an Amazon Machine Image
to create a virtual machine.
It is like a normal terminal, but everything that goes on, goes on
in the cloud.
EMR (Elastic Map Reduce) handles Big Data effectively. It uses a
hosted “Hadoop” framework on the AMI.
Amazon Route 53 and Amazon Virtual Private Cloud (VPC) are
the two networking branches of AWS.
While the former handles DNS based server leasing and
associated services like cPanel integration, the latter can establish
a VPN connection (secure connection) between EC2 servers and
any other network.
It is implemented when a secure connection is to be established
for privileged access or encryption while real-time deployment of
AWS services.
Amazon is known as one of the first content delivery services to
exist with a cloud backbone.
The simple storage service (S3) provides web based storage for
AWS clients.
A low cost alternative to the S3 is the Amazon Glacier, which can
be used for long term storage.
There are others that vary with space and security degree of the
data being stored.
While Amazon takes care of the data its clients store on its
servers, it is prudent to have some security layers of your own
while deploying system applications on the AWS cloud servers
like privileged access and encryption.
Probably the most important part of the application
implementation for organizations is a reliable storage and
database management services.
AWS have it integrated in its environment. DynamoDB is a low
cost NoSQL database for professional applications.
Amazon RDS is also another option that includes MySQL and
Informix.
There are a lot of other options which comply to different
development requirements.
One should go through the AWS manual before choosing
one.
